What “best” means for sellers

Generic image models can look impressive, but sellers care about usable listing assets: consistent product shape, clean backgrounds, readable props, and platform-ready framing.

Evaluate tools on identity lock, marketplace fit, turnaround time, and how much manual fix-up remains after generation.

FAQ

Is Midjourney enough for Amazon product images?

Midjourney is strong for creative concepts, but sellers often still need product-identity control, white-background directions, and marketplace framing. Ecommerce-native tools reduce that gap.

What should a seller test first?

Upload one clear product photo and request a white-background main image plus one lifestyle scene. Compare identity accuracy, edge quality, and how much retouching remains.
